Low-budget ethnic drama about an aspiring comic illustrator (Manny Perez) who must weigh ambition against responsibility when his bodega-owning father (Tomas Milian) is shot and paralyzed during a robbery. With a contrived plot not worth emotional investment, director Alfredo de Villa's cliched narrative is undermined by the protagonist's all-too-familiar dilemma: how to escape his dead-end existence while maintaining his cultural identity. Sexual situations with nudity, violence and recurring rough language and vulgarities The USCCB Office for Film & Broadcasting classification is A-IV -- adults, with reservations. The Motion Picture Association of America rating is R -- restricted.
